dioscoreáceo , a . ( Of Dioscórides , famous Greek physician). 1. adj. Bot. Says of the Angiosperms, Monocots, herbaceous plants with fickle stems, often with tuberous roots or rhizomes, leaves opposite or alternate, heart-shaped, flowers actinomorphic, often Unisexual, in raceme or spike, and fruit in capsule or Berry; e.g., Yam. U t. c. s. f. 2. f. pl. Bot. These plant family. O RTOGR. ESCR. with may. initial.
